This is what I have:
Spring turkey hunting in Alabama for easterns on over 1,000 acres of private land. Includes a place to stay (a nice one at that and yes, photos & references are available) Nearest small town is Camden, Alabama.
Nearest big city Montgomery on I-65 (about 1.5 hours)
We have good fishing for Largemouth bass & Bluegill, our biggest bass so far is 11#, last summer.
Got catfish CATCHING too! (you pick the method on the catfish, I prefer a dip net)You have to be there to understand.....

The season runs March 20th to April 30th.
Non-Resident License is under $100. I think it's $77.00 over the counter. see below: http://www.dcnr.state.al.us/agfdee
There is a 4 gobbler limit per season.
This is not a commercial hunt and I can make no Promises BUT we have LOTS of birds!
As of today, Alabama does not allow decoys.
We only hunt the deer & We plant over 20 acres of summer & fall foodplots and have some really nice hardwood bottoms and eastern red cedar flats.
There are several well known Guided hunting Lodges nearby, Portland Hunting reserve in about 1/2 hour away has similar terrain.
The Little Lady Will Like it Because it's only 2.5 hours from the Beaches on the Gulf of Mexico at Orange Beach or Gulf shores.
